Obituary for Jacqueline Jane "Jackie" Dewyer (Murawski)

Jacqueline “Jackie” J. Dewyer

Jacqueline “Jackie” J. Dewyer, age 82 of Ludington passed away peacefully on Saturday December 31, 2016 at Tendercare of Ludington.
She was born on August 15, 1934 in Ludington, daughter of the late Stanley and Ida (Krzyanowski) Murawski. Jackie enjoyed doing arts and crafts, playing bingo, going to the casino and spending time with her family.
Jackie is survived by her sons, Robert (Lorraine) Dewyer and Charlie (Ellouise) Dewyer; daughters-in-law, Julie Murawski and Christie Dewyer; grandchildren, Barbie (Dan) Young, Jennifer (Jeff) Johnson, Steve (Roxanne Robertson) Davis, Brandy (James Mulder) Murawski, Michael (Melanie St. John) Pilon, Brooke (Timothy) Castonia and Rachel (Leonard) Bellows; great-grandchildren, Jonathan, Josh, Haley and Anthony Davis, Jonathan and Julie Johnson, Abby Mulder, Madison, Baily and Mason Pilon, Whitney and Lacie Sroka and Trevor Castonia; great-great-grandchildren, Wyatt Copsey and Thomas Bellows.
She is preceded in death by her parents; 2 sons, Michael Murawski and Larry Dewyer; and grandson, Jeremiah Dewyer.
Cremation has taken place and no services at planned at this time. Final interment will take place in the spring at Pere Marquette Catholic Cemetery in Ludington. Memorial contributions in memory of Jackie may be directed to the Dewyer family.
